Understanding Audience Segmentation: Tailoring Your Public Relations Efforts

You know what? In the dizzyingly complex world of public relations, one size definitely does not fit all. When it comes to communicating with different audiences, understanding their unique characteristics is crucial. Enter audience segmentation—a powerful tool used by PR professionals to craft tailored communications that resonate with specific groups.

So, What’s the Goal of Audience Segmentation?

Imagine sending out a press release that resonates deeply with a targeted group. That’s the magic of audience segmentation, which aims for customized communication rather than a generic message that misses the mark. This practice allows communicators to touch on specific interests, needs, and characteristics that define their audience segments. Sounds pretty efficient, right?

Let’s break down how this works. By diving into the nitty-gritty details of demographics, psychographics, and behaviors, PR practitioners can create message strategies that engage and connect with their audience in a relevant way. It’s like speaking someone’s language. Wouldn’t you want someone to communicate with you in a way that feels personal?

The Power of Customized Communication in PR

The beauty of customized communication lies in its ability to enhance the effectiveness of PR campaigns. Think about it: different groups often react in distinct ways to the same message. A savvy public relations strategist recognizes this and crafts messages that hit home for each specific audience.

This approach acknowledges one critical truth—audiences are not monolithic. For instance, the way a tech-savvy millennial interacts with social media differs vastly from how a retired individual might perceive the same platform. So, why send them both the same information

every time? That’s like trying to use one tool for every project—ineffective and frustrating!

The Downside of Generic Messaging

On the flip side, embracing a generic messaging strategy can dilute communication effectiveness considerably. If you’re broadcasting the same message to every conceivable audience, you risk pushing your followers away rather than drawing them in. Take a second to think about it. When was the last time a bland, mass-produced message really caught your attention? Probably not too often!

While generating very detailed reports can seem beneficial, dumping endless stats and demographic insights doesn’t automatically translate into meaningful communication. After all, it’s not just about gathering data; it’s about applying it strategically to your content.

Moreover, a sole focus on mass communication might lead to oversights of audience specific preferences and behaviors. This means potentially missing out on opportunities to connect and engage—forging stronger relationships with your audience. Who would want that?
